Santa Cruz Museum of Art & History
The Santa Cruz Museum of Art & History, located at 705 Front Street in Santa Cruz, California, is a vibrant cultural institution and tourist attraction. With three floors of bilingual exhibitions, events, educational resources, and community collaborations, the museum invites visitors to explore and connect with the creative and curious. Featuring the artwork of renowned artist Richard Mayhew, whose paintings capture the essence of music, mood, and the inner soul, the museum offers a rare and timely exhibition that speaks to American arts, culture, and history. Additionally, the museum hosts community-driven exhibitions that highlight the stories of Filipino migration and labor in the Pajaro Valley, as well as the untold stories of the people who have shaped Santa Cruz County.

The Lofts at the Tannery
The Lofts at the Tannery is a unique institution located at 1040 River Street in Santa Cruz, California. It is part of the first-in-the-nation, interdisciplinary, and multicultural arts campus that provides an accessible, sustainable, and vibrant Home for the Arts in Santa Cruz County. The Tannery Arts Center is a project of Artspace Inc. and the City of Santa Cruz Economic Development Department. The eight-acre campus is home to twenty-eight commercial rate art studios and one hundred affordable rate residential apartments. The John Stewart Company provides property management for the campus, while the Arts Council Santa Cruz County provides programming, coordination, and communications.
